AI Summary
- Amends § 1334 of Title 11 (Delaware Code) to expand prohibited uses of unmanned aircraft systems by adding four new criminal offenses related to drones
- Criminalizes operating a drone to harass another person on private property in violation of § 1311(a)
- Criminalizes operating a drone to invade the privacy of another person on private property in violation of § 1335(a)(1), (2), (3), (4), or (6)
- Criminalizes operating a drone to violate or fail to obey protective orders issued by Delaware Family Court, state/territorial/Indian nation courts, or Canadian courts (when violation occurs in Delaware)
- Violations are punished as an unclassified misdemeanor for first offense, class B misdemeanor for second or subsequent offense, or class A misdemeanor if physical injury or property damage results
Legislative Description
An Act To Amend Title 11 Of The Delaware Code Relating To Unmanned Aircraft Systems.
